VMware作为虚拟化软件的领导者,提供了强大的平台来运行多个操作系统,而CentOS作为一个开源、免费、基于Red Hat Enterprise Linux(RHEL) 的操作系统,以其稳定性和性能赢得了众多开发者和企业的青睐
本文将详细指导你如何在VMware上安装CentOS,确保每一步都清晰明了,使你能够顺利完成安装
一、准备工作 在开始安装之前,确保你具备以下条件: 1.VMware软件:确保你已经安装了最新版本的VMware Workstation Pro或VMware Player
如果还没有安装,可以从【VMware官方网站】(https://www.vmware.com/products/workstation-pro.html)下载并安装
2.CentOS镜像文件:前往【CentOS官方网站】(https://www.centos.org/download/)下载你需要的CentOS版本
由于某些网络限制,你可能需要使用一些特殊的网络工具来访问该网站
你也可以选择从其他可信的开源镜像站下载,例如阿里云开源镜像站或搜狐开源镜像站
3.CPU虚拟化支持:确保你的CPU支持并启用了虚拟化技术(如Intel的VT-x或AMD的AMD-V)
你可以在BIOS或UEFI设置中检查并启用这一功能
二、创建虚拟机 1.打开VMware:启动VMware Workstation Pro或VMware Player
2.新建虚拟机:在VMware主界面,点击“文件”菜单,选择“新建虚拟机”
3.选择典型配置:在新建虚拟机向导中,选择“典型(推荐)”,然后点击“下一步”
4.稍后安装操作系统:选择“稍后安装操作系统”,然后点击“下一步”
5.选择操作系统:在客户机操作系统选项中,选择“Linux”,版本选择“CentOS 7 64位”
注意,虽然这里以CentOS 7为例,但步骤对其他版本也大致相同
6.命名虚拟机:为虚拟机命名,并选择安装位置
建议选择剩余空间较大的磁盘分区,并为虚拟机创建一个单独的文件夹
7.配置磁盘大小:设置最大磁盘大小,建议至少20GB
选择“将虚拟磁盘拆分成多个文件”,然后点击“下一步”
8.完成创建:检查配置无误后,点击“完成”
三、配置虚拟机参数 1.设置ISO镜像文件:在虚拟机窗口中,点击“编辑虚拟机设置”
在CD/DVD(IDE)选项中,选择“使用ISO映像文件”,然后浏览并选择你下载的CentOS镜像文件
2.配置内存:在虚拟机设置中,你可以调整分配给虚拟机的内存大小
建议至少分配2GB内存,以确保系统流畅运行
3.配置网络:在网络适配器选项中,选择“NAT模式”
NAT模式允许虚拟机通过宿主机的网络连接外部网络
四、安装CentOS 1.启动虚拟机:点击虚拟机窗口中的“开启此虚拟机”按钮
2.开始安装:在虚拟机启动后,使用键盘选择“Install CentOS 7”,然后按下回车键(Enter)
3.选择语言:在安装界面中,选择中文作为安装语言,然后点击“继续”
4.设置时间和日期:选择正确的时区,例如“上海”,然后点击“完成”
5.软件选择:在软件选择界面中,勾选“GNOME桌面”和“开发工具”
这将安装一个带有图形用户界面的CentOS系统,并包含常用的开发工具
6.配置分区:在安装位置选项中,选择“我要配置分区(自定义)”
然后选择“标准分区”,并点击“完成”
- 创建/boot分区:挂载点填写/boot,容量建议为200MB至1GB
- 创建swap分区:选择swap类型,大小建议为物理内存的1至2倍
- 创建根分区/:挂载点填写/,容量建议为10GB以上
确认无误后,点击“接受更改”
7.设置网络和主机名:在网络配置中,可以设置主机名和配置网络
你可以暂时使用默认设置,在安装完成后进行更详细的配置
8.开始安装:点击“开始安装”按钮,系统将开始安装过程
在安装过程中,你可以设置root密码和创建新用户
9.完成安装:安装完成后,点击“重启”按钮
五、配置和初始化CentOS 1.许可协议:重启后,接受许可协议,并点击“完成配置”
2.登录系统:使用你创建的用户名和密码登录CentOS系统
3.初始化设置: - 选择汉语作为系统语言
- 设置时区和其他偏好
4.配置网络: - 打开终端,输入`su`切换到root用户,然后输入root密码
-输入`ifconfig`查看网卡名称
-使用`vi`编辑器编辑网卡配置文件,通常位于`/etc/sysconfig/network-scripts/`目录下,文件名以`ifcfg-`开头,后跟网卡名称
-将`ONBOOT`参数改为`yes`,保存并退出
-输入`systemctl restart network`重启网络服务
-使用`ip add`查看IP地址,使用`ping www.baidu.com`测试网络连接
5.配置固定IP地址(可选): - 编辑网卡配置文件,添加或修改`IPADDR`、`GATEWAY`和`NETMASK`参数
- 保存并退出编辑器
- 重启网络服务
6.其他设置: - 取消自动锁屏设置:在系统设置中的隐私选项中,将自动锁屏设置为关闭
- 取消自动空白屏幕:在电源设置中,将空白屏幕设置为“从不”
- 备份快照:定期拍摄虚拟机的快照,以防止数据丢失
六、总结 通过本文的详细步骤,你应该能够成功在VMware上安装并配置CentOS系统
无论是对于初学者还是有一定经验的用户,本文都提供了全面而详细的指导
CentOS以其稳定性和强大的功能,结合VMware的虚拟化技术,将为你提供一个高效、灵活的开发和测试环境
希望本文对你有所帮助,祝你安装顺利!